当前位置: 首页 > vue项目
-
如何配置 VSCode 以支持 Node.js 开发环境?
配置VSCode支持Node.js开发需先安装Node.js运行时,再通过安装ESLint、Prettier、DotENV、RESTClient、GitLens等扩展并配置settings.json、launch.json和tasks.json文件,实现代码规范、自动格式化、环境变量管理、API测试和高效调试,从而构建高效开发环境。
VSCode 3102025-09-26 21:58:02
-
HTML代码怎么美化_HTML代码样式美化技巧与CSS结合使用方法
答案是:HTML代码美化需以语义化结构为基础,通过CSS实现视觉与性能的平衡。首先,使用语义化标签提升可读性、SEO和可访问性;其次,采用外部样式表、优化选择器、模块化命名(如BEM)及Flexbox/Grid布局提升CSS效率;最后,借助Prettier、Sass、PostCSS、Stylelint等工具自动化格式化、增强可维护性并保障代码质量,从而构建清晰、高效、易维护的前端代码体系。
html教程 4832025-09-25 18:24:02
-
怎样利用 VSCode 进行多语言国际化开发?
答案:利用VSCode进行多语言国际化开发需结合i18n库与扩展工具,首先按语言分类管理JSON/YAML翻译文件,使用i18n-ally实现翻译预览、自动补全和硬编码提取;选择适配框架的库如react-i18next或vue-i18n,并通过ESLint、Prettier和Git工作流确保翻译质量与协作效率;借助代码片段、任务脚本和Hook自动化校验,提升开发效率与准确性。
VSCode 7492025-09-24 23:14:01
-
解决Laravel+Vue登录页面重载问题:自定义用户名字段认证
本文旨在解决Laravel+Vue应用中常见的登录页面重载问题,该问题通常发生在登录表单使用username字段而非默认email进行认证时。我们将详细介绍Laravel认证机制,分析问题根源,并提供如何通过覆盖认证控制器中的username()方法来适配自定义用户名字段的解决方案,确保用户能够正常登录,并提供实用的调试建议。
php教程 9212025-09-24 12:06:13
-
VSCode的扩展激活事件有哪些不同类型和策略?
答案:VSCode扩展激活事件决定扩展何时被唤醒,核心是按需激活以提升性能。常见类型包括onCommand、onLanguage、workspaceContains等,应避免使用*和onStartupFinished以防影响启动速度。选择合适事件需结合功能场景与用户行为,通过延迟加载、动态导入等方式优化性能,利用内置工具诊断问题,确保扩展轻量高效。
VSCode 6622025-09-21 19:19:01
-
如何在vue项目中灵活使用css引入方式
Vue项目中CSS引入方式多样,需根据需求选择。行内样式适用于简单场景但不利于维护;全局样式在main.js或单独文件中引入,适合reset.css等通用样式;组件局部样式通过scoped属性限制作用域,避免冲突;CSSModules通过对类名哈希化实现样式的模块化,确保唯一性,可通过$style访问,提升可维护性;使用Sass/Less等预处理器支持变量、嵌套、mixin等特性,增强CSS可读性与复用性,需安装对应loader并在中启用;处理全局样式时应避免污染,推荐语义化命名和精确选择器;对
css教程 6342025-09-21 12:28:01
-
怎么利用JavaScript进行前端国际化?
前端国际化是通过将文本抽离为语言包,按需加载并替换界面内容,实现多语言支持。核心步骤包括:使用JSON等格式管理键值对翻译、根据用户语言环境动态加载对应文件、通过函数获取翻译文本并处理变量替换。基础方案可自行实现,但实际项目多采用成熟库如i18next、react-i18next、vue-i18n等,以支持复数、格式化、上下文等复杂场景。选型时需考虑框架适配性、功能需求、团队熟悉度和包体积。常见挑战包括翻译流程管理(可用TMS系统解决)、复数与上下文处理、RTL布局支持、性能优化(如按需加载)。
js教程 3752025-09-20 18:18:01
-
VSCode的扩展配置如何实现条件加载和动态启用?
答案:通过VSCodeProfiles、工作区设置和activationEvents实现扩展的条件加载与动态启用,提升性能与环境一致性。用户可利用Profiles按项目隔离扩展,结合settings.json微调行为,开发者则通过package.json中的activationEvents(如onLanguage、workspaceContains)控制激活时机,并在代码中监听配置变化或按需加载模块,实现精细化管理,避免资源浪费与扩展冲突,确保多场景下开发环境高效、一致。
VSCode 8522025-09-20 17:34:01
-
怎么利用JavaScript进行前端代码质量评估?
答案:前端代码质量评估需系统整合JavaScript工具链,涵盖静态分析、测试、性能与安全审计。首先使用ESLint和Prettier统一代码风格与规范;其次通过Jest、Cypress等实现单元、集成及端到端测试;再结合Lighthouse、axe-core进行性能与可访问性检测;最后在CI/CD中分层引入husky预提交检查、CI阶段自动化测试与安全扫描,确保代码健壮、可维护且用户友好。
js教程 7752025-09-20 15:54:01
-
如何配置 VSCode 以支持 Vue.js 开发?
安装Volar扩展以获得Vue3全面语言支持,配置ESLint进行代码质量检查,集成Prettier实现统一格式化,并通过VSCode设置确保保存时自动格式化,从而保障Vue.js开发环境的高效与规范。
VSCode 6672025-09-19 19:38:01
-
sublime如何配置vue语法高亮和提示_Sublime Vue语法高亮与代码提示配置方法
首先安装PackageControl,再通过它安装VueSyntaxHighlight实现语法高亮,安装VueCompletions获得代码提示,最后手动关联.vue文件类型以确保正确解析,从而在SublimeText中构建高效Vue开发环境。
sublime 8762025-09-19 13:10:02
-
怎么利用JavaScript进行前端自动化测试?
前端自动化测试需根据项目需求选择合适工具,核心是通过JavaScript框架如Jest、ReactTestingLibrary、Cypress、Playwright等实现单元、组件、集成和端到端测试,构建分层策略以提升质量与效率。
js教程 5642025-09-19 10:05:01
-
怎么利用JavaScript进行前端模块热替换?
HMR通过替换修改的模块实现局部更新,保留应用状态。其依赖Webpack的module.hot.accept机制,在React中使用ReactRefresh、Vue中通过vue-loader集成,相比LiveReload避免了页面刷新,提升了开发效率。
js教程 5972025-09-17 14:07:01
-
在Vue.js组件中集成和渲染Twig模板内容
在Vue.js应用中直接嵌入和渲染Twig模板是不可能的,因为它们分别处理客户端和服务器端渲染。本文将探讨两种有效的替代方案:一是将Twig模板的逻辑和结构完全迁移到Vue组件中实现;二是利用HTTP请求从后端获取已渲染的TwigHTML内容,并通过Vue的v-html指令安全地将其注入到组件中。文章将详细阐述这两种方法的实现细节、适用场景以及注意事项,帮助开发者在Vue项目中灵活处理Twig内容。
php教程 5662025-09-12 22:01:13
-
Vue 3项目中图像资源的集成与SVG组件化实践
本教程旨在详细阐述在Vue3项目中集成和使用图像资源的多种策略,尤其聚焦于SVG图像的特殊处理。我们将涵盖传统的标签加载、CSSbackground-image应用,并针对Vue3环境下SVG作为可控组件的导入与使用提供一套清晰的解决方案,强调如何规避旧版加载器不兼容问题,确保SVG资源的正确渲染与优化。
js教程 3762025-09-12 11:43:23
-
解决Vue3项目中Pinia与vue-demi版本冲突问题
本文旨在解决Vue3项目中出现"hasInjectionContext"isnotexportedby"node_modules/vue-demi/lib/index.mjs",importedby"node_modules/pinia/dist/pinia.mjs"错误的问题。该问题通常由于pinia与vue-demi以及vue的版本不兼容导致。通过升级Vue版本,可以有效解决此问题,确保Pinia能够正确运行。
js教程 5862025-09-06 18:45:03
社区问答
-
vue3+tp6怎么加入微信公众号啊
阅读:4955 · 6个月前
-
老师好,当客户登录并立即发送消息,这时候客服又并不在线,这时候发消息会因为touid没有赋值而报错,怎么处理?
阅读:5980 · 7个月前
-
RPC模式
阅读:4995 · 7个月前
-
insert时,如何避免重复注册?
阅读:5787 · 9个月前
-
vite 启动项目报错 不管用yarn 还是cnpm
阅读:6381 · 10个月前
最新文章
-
巧文书AI官方网站最新链接 巧文书AI智能写作生成官网直达首页
阅读:970 · 46分钟前
-
qq邮箱企业版和个人版的区别_QQ企业邮箱与个人邮箱功能差异
阅读:177 · 48分钟前
-
Golang如何处理HTTP请求重试_Golang HTTP请求重试实践详解
阅读:250 · 50分钟前
-
c++中为什么析构函数通常是public的_析构函数访问控制的原因与影响
阅读:342 · 53分钟前
-
windows10照片应用打不开或闪退的解决方法_windows10照片应用修复方法
阅读:671 · 55分钟前
-
windows11如何解决“你的组织管理某些设置”提示_Windows 11组织策略相关提示解决方法
阅读:766 · 56分钟前
-
如何在Golang中减少内存复制开销_Golang内存复制优化方法汇总
阅读:901 · 58分钟前
-
x浏览器官方网站入口_x浏览器平台直达主页官方链接
阅读:839 · 1小时前
-
在css中border-top border-bottom颜色分别设置
阅读:941 · 1小时前
-
LocoySpider如何集成OCR文字识别_LocoySpiderOCR集成的图像处理
阅读:739 · 1小时前


